Yesterday, PennSTAR’s medical helicopter landed at its new home, Penn Medicine Doylestown Hospital. PennSTAR leadership and crew were on-site to answer questions while giving a close-up look at the aircraft's capabilities. The PennSTAR Flight Program provides critical care air and ground medical transportation to the Tri-State Area within a 100-mile radius of Penn Medicine. Three medical helicopters and two critical care ambulances provide rapid transport of critical care patients and on-scene services at the site of accidents and trauma-related incidents. The PennSTAR helicopter is larger, faster and more spacious than the previous model that served the hospital. This helicopter was specifically designed for Medivac service, with the ability to operate safely in varied weather conditions, at night, or in controlled spaces.

We’re excited to share that AInSights, an AI system developed by a team at Penn Medicine, won Healthcare Innovation’s 2025 Innovator Award for its significant clinical impact. This powerful tool helps providers diagnose diseases and create better treatment plans by giving more precise, 3D views of internal organs—automatically and seamlessly providing information at a volume that greatly improves staff workflows and patient outcomes.http://spr.ly/60464gMCG

Eight years ago, just one year after he joined Doylestown Health, primary care physician assistant Dan Hemple enlisted in the Pennsylvania National Guard. "I desired to give back to the country that has given so much to me," said Hemple, who feels both roles help him be a better version of himself. Recently promoted to major, Hemple was awarded the Army Commendation Medal for the dedicated care he provided to American troops in Germany and Ukrainian soldiers pulled from the front lines.

Congratulations Soujanya Jammalamadaka, MD, Family Medicine Resident, for receiving the Pennsylvania Academy of Family Physicians (PAFP) Resident Impact Grant for her research titled, “Improving Healthcare Access to LGBTQIA+ Community.” Dr. Jammalamadaka presented her research proposal with collaborator Anthony Scarmaia, MD, Family Medicine Resident, at the PAFP Connect Conference in early April. The study received approval from the University of Pennsylvania Institutional Review Boards. Congratulations Brenda Foley, MD, medical director of the Emergency Department (ED) at Penn Medicine Doylestown Health, for being the inaugural recipient of the Scott Levy, MD, Physician Trailblazer Award. Established in 2024 to honor Dr. Scott Levy’s commitment to innovation and quality throughout his 30-plus-year tenure at Doylestown Health, the award recognizes innovative physicians. Dr. Foley was nominated for this award and received unanimous support from Doylestown Health’s Medical staff for her exemplary commitment, advocating for patients and innovating ways to reduce opioid-related harm.
